UNESCO Briefing Held on 2026 Water Conference in Dushanbe
Read also
A briefing on preparations for the Fourth High-Level International Conference on the International Decade for Action, “Water for Sustainable Development, 2018–2028,” was held at UNESCO headquarters in Paris at the initiative of the Permanent Delegation of Tajikistan.
According to the Ministry of Foreign Affairs of Tajikistan, the briefing brought together representatives of UNESCO agencies and member states to discuss the objectives, agenda, expected outcomes and logistical arrangements for the conference, scheduled for May 25–28, 2026, in Dushanbe.
Dilshod Rahimi outlined the government’s preparations and highlighted the importance of Tajikistan’s global initiatives in the field of water resources management.
